Ever since his first look was unveiled, Sanjay Dutt’s Adheera has become one of the talking points of KGF: Chapter 2. The actor, playing the ruthless antagonist, will be seen locking horns with Yash in Prashanth Neel’s action thriller that releases today. Unlike his fans who are eager to watch the second instalment, Dutt reveals that daughter Iqra will skip the film. The 11-year-old has her reasons. “Iqra doesn’t watch movies where my character dies. Every time I sign a movie, her first question is, ‘Are you going to die in the film?’ Shahraan, on the other hand, is excited. I have been told that he is boasting about the film to his friends at school,” laughs Dutt. 




Regardless of its box-office fate, KGF: Chapter 2 will remain etched in Dutt’s memory. It was during the film’s shoot in 2020 that he was diagnosed with lung cancer. After his recovery, the actor bounced back to complete the filming. “I [resumed] my training as soon as the doctors and my body allowed it. I have been leading a disciplined life since my illness.” The post-recovery journey has been challenging, but he insists it has only made him emotionally stronger. “I was blessed to have Maanayata and the kids by my side. My wife has been my biggest strength and my kids, my motivation through this journey.”
